Global crude steel production volumes continued to rise year on year in October 2018, according to statistics published by the World Steel Association (Worldsteel) on Friday November 23.World crude steel output totaled 156.6 million tonnes in October this year, compared with 148 million tonnes in the corresponding month of 2017. CO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o., Nov. 26, 2018 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- via NEWMEDIAWIRE -- Gold Resource Corporation (NYSE American: GORO) (the "Company") declares its monthly instituted dividend of 1/6 of a cent per common share for November 2018 payable on December 24, 2018 to shareholders of record as of December 11, 2018. Prices for ferro-vanadium and vanadium pentoxide from China slipped in the week ended Friday November 23 after sellers cut their export offers amid a lull in consumer buying and hesitance to purchasing at high levels. The Chinese ferro-silicon market rebounded in the week ended Friday November 23 when low stock levels at smelters met with renewed demand from consumers, while the European market is in a holding pattern while waiting to settle longer-term delivery settlements with steel mills.
